Microsoft rumored to give fans closer look at new Gears of War and Tomb Raider games at E3

Microsoft's turn at the E3 stage is always one that fans look forward to as they anticipate the arrival of new games from the company. The company is promising to release in-depth looks of their scheduled games for release including Gears of War and Tomb Raider.

Even though Microsoft is not slated to appear at E3 until the morning of June 15, they are already giving fans a heads up as to what they should be looking out for. Microsoft is not just giving a rundown of games they are planning to release for 2015, as it looks like some other projects further into the future could also be presented at E3.

Microsoft has already confirmend that one of the developers they are working for, The Coalition, will be bringing its work to E3, according to Polygon. If all the Internet rumors out there at the moment are correct, then that particular developer should be delivering news regarding the still unannounced Gears of War game.

The company is also sending a ton of notable personalities to their E3 presentation.

None other than Larry "Major Nelson" Hryb and Graeme "Acey Bongos" Boyd will act as co-hosts for the event, according to Express UK. Phil Specter, Head of Xbox, will also be making an appearance at the presentation.

As for the still unofficial announcements, Crave Online is speculating that Microsoft will showcase Rise of the Tomb Raider, the Xbox exclusive that could potentially be one of the biggest title's in the company's history.

For fans who may not be able to attend E3 to catch the presentation, Microsoft will livestream the event on both the Xbox One and 360. The event will also be showing on the Xbox website as well as on Windows Phones. Spike TV will also be carrying the event proceedings on cable television during their "Xbox: Game On" show.
